About Bugge Wesseltoft

Bugge Wesseltoft is the Norwegian pianist and producer who founded nu-jazz, the fusion of acoustic jazz with electronica and club rhythms. His New Conception of Jazz project, launched in 1996, brought DJ culture and studio production into the jazz tradition and influenced a generation of European players. He founded the label Jazzland Recordings, which became the hub of the Norwegian electronic-jazz scene, and has collaborated widely with Sidsel Endresen, Henrik Schwarz, and the wider ECM-adjacent world.
